Avocado: The Creamy Heart of the Dish

The avocado is, of course, the star here. Choosing the right avocado is crucial for the best texture and flavor. Look for avocados that are ripe but still firm. They should yield slightly to gentle pressure when squeezed, but not feel mushy or overly soft. Avoid avocados with large dark spots or bruises. If your avocado is too hard, let it ripen on the counter for a day or two. If it’s too soft, it might be overripe and stringy. A perfectly ripe avocado brings a buttery, rich creaminess that elevates this salad. Black Beans: The Earthy Foundation

Canned black beans are a fantastic, convenient shortcut that doesn't compromise on flavor or nutrition. However, a crucial step often overlooked is rinsing them thoroughly. Drain the beans from their can and rinse them under cold running water until the water runs clear. This removes excess sodium and also improves their texture, making them less mushy and more distinct in your salad. It also ensures that the natural flavor of the beans comes through, rather than any metallic taste from the can. Ultimate Avocado and Black Bean Salad

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

A vibrant, refreshing, and incredibly satisfying salad featuring creamy avocado, hearty black beans, crisp vegetables, and a zesty lime dressing. Perfect as a light meal, side dish, or topping.

  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ale

2 ripe but firm avocados, diced
1 (15-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
1/2 red bell pepper, finely chopped
1/4 red onion, finely minced
1/2 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
2 tablespoons fresh lime juice (from about 1-2 limes)
1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in (optional)
Salt to taste
Freshly ground black pepper to taste

Instructions

Step 1: Begin by preparing your black beans. Drain them completely from their can and rinse them thoroughly under cold running water in a colander until all the cloudy liquid is gone. Let them drain for a few minutes.
Step 2: Dice the avocados. Cut each avocado in half lengthwise, remove the pit, and score the flesh in a crosshatch pattern without piercing the skin. Scoop out the diced avocado with a spoon into a large mixing bowl. Aim for roughly 1/2 to 3/4-inch pieces.
Step 3: Prepare the other vegetables. Finely mince the red onion; a fine mince ensures its flavor is distributed without being overpowering. Chop the bell pepper into small, even pieces, similar in size to the avocado dice. Roughly chop the fresh cilantro.
Step 4: Combine all the main ingredients in the large mixing bowl. Add the rinsed black beans, diced avocado, minced red onion, chopped bell pepper, and fresh cilantro.
Step 5: Dress the salad. In a small separate bowl, whisk together the fresh lime juice, extra virgin olive oil, ground cumin (if using), and a pinch of salt and black pepper.
Step 6: Season and gently toss. Pour the dressing over the ingredients in the large bowl. Using a large spoon or spatula, gently fold the ingredients together. Be careful not to overmix, as this can mash the delicate avocado. The goal is to coat everything evenly while keeping the avocado pieces intact.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ed, adding more salt, pepper, or lime juice to your preference. Serve immediately or chill for 30 minutes for flavors to meld.

Notes

For best results, use fresh lime juice. To prevent avocados from browning, ensure they are well-coated with the lime dressing and store any leftovers in an airtight container with minimal air exposure.
